    Year of the sequel

    If it isn't enough that movies these days come with strings of sequels and prequels, it seems as if games are following suit. This year, expect to see the releases of sequels of HUGE franchises - namely Red Alert 3 and Fallout 3. Ahh, those great memories of nuking whole bases and hitting kids in the groin with a sledgehammer - priceless... Starcraft 2 is coming in the pipeline as well, but don't expect it to hit shelves until next year. The sad thing is, my 3+ year old machine is way underpowered to handle the graphics in modern games and probably won't be able to run them until I manage to get a leaner and meaner computer. In the meantime, however, I get to watch tantalising previews of them.



    I like the idea of utilising the sea in an RTS as it expands on the naval aspect of previous RA games and RA3 would probably be the first RTS to make naval warfare an integral, if not crucial, part of the gaming experience. A great move in my books since I've always wondered why RTS designers have shied away from having more naval units/structures. Plus, Tesla Coils on water look fully sick!
